Every September 29, we celebrate the Feast Day of the Archangels — Saint Michael, Saint Gabriel, and Saint Raphael. Michael, (God’s warrior) was the archangel who fought against Satan and all his evil angels, defending all the friends of God. He is the protector of all humanity from the ‘snares of the devil’. Saint Francis is remembered for his generosity to the poor, his willingness to minister to the lepers, and for his love for animals and nature. He is the Catholic Church’s patron saint of animals and the environment. In honor of Saint Francis of Assisi, the blessing of animals shows that all of God’s creatures are [...]
